It’s the feelgood art exhibit of the spring. Swiss artist Comenius Roethlisberger just dismantled his “Dearest constellation, sweetest invitation” installation at Colette. The controversial exhibit, celebrating the end of Paris A/W fashion week, featured logos of luxury brands written with a mix of sugar powder and cocaine, all presented in clear polyester resine boxes. The book/art show beautiful losers has been the inspiration for a new documentary about street art and outsider art that made it into the galleries and mainstream culture, featuring the likes of Shepard Fairey (Obey), Harmony Korine, Kaws, Glen E. Friedman, Robert Crumb and Mike Mills.
